Rear deck rattle/buzz
im pretty sure someone posted a while back that the issue was a free metal ball like piece within the rear seat belt assembly and the fix by the dealer was to replace with new one... and another posted that it was the trunk light wire from what i can remember.
On further research it seems that the wire was an issue for some but didnt work for everyone...

^^ I was aware of those two possibilities, I tapped the seatbelt assemblys and wrapped the assemblys in dynomat to be sure, i also made sure the trunk light wire was not the source. Believe me I went through it checking all TSB possibilities. Im going to stuff a bunch of foam in the crevices around the wheel well and behind the rear/right of the rear deck area to try and quiet the noise. Im convinced (but not totally sure) its a loose spot weld or something in the hollow space behind the sheet metal... any imput or thoughts are appreciated.. oh yea, when cold its the loudest, when hot its hardly noticable..im reaching the end of my search for it but I would love to find the root cause..
my car developed an intermittent rattle. after a bit of knocking around, i gently kicked the right tailpipe and there it was. the exhaust isn't fastened well enough somewhere. i will update when i get that resolved.
rattle here as well, i thought it was coming from the exhaust until i got up under there and shook everything. its most likely something in the rear decklid. it will happen usually when im sitting still in drive. it doesnt do it when im moving. when the engine is revving down it happens as well. its definately some sort of frequency related issue
